Gudpara

Gudpara is a village located in Rajnagar tehsil of Chhatarpur district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 35km away from sub-district headquarter Rajnagar (tehsildar office) and 28km away from district headquarter Chhatarpur. As per 2009 stats, Sandani is the gram panchayat of Gudpara village.

About Gudpara

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Gudpara is 458034. The village spans a total geographical area of 194.39 hectares. Chhatarpur is nearest town to Gudpara village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 28km away.

Population of Gudpara

Below is a concise population overview of Gudpara as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,056 547 509
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 214 104 110
Scheduled Castes (SC) 195 97 98
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 377 252 125
Illiterate Population 679 295 384

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Gudpara village:

  • The total population of Gudpara village is around 1,056, including approximately 547 males and 509 females, with a sex ratio of 930 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 214 children aged 0–6 years in Gudpara village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Gudpara village has 195 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Gudpara village is about 35.70%, with male literacy at 46.07% and female literacy at 24.56%.
  • There are around 214 households in Gudpara village.

Connectivity of Gudpara

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Gudpara. As per the 2011 stats, Gudpara had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
